
Chicken Teriyaki Donburi
Servings: 4
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 30 minutes
Total Time: 45 minutes
Ingredients:
- 500 grams Skinless chicken thighs
- 1/4 cup Soy Sauce
- 1/4 cup Mirin
- 2 tablespoons Sugar
- 2 cloves Garlic cloves, crushed
- 1 tablespoon Ginger, grated
- 4 cups Cooked white rice
- 4 stalks Spring onions, chopped
Instructions:
- In a bowl, combine soy sauce, mirin, sugar, crushed garlic and grated ginger to make the teriyaki sauce.
- Place the chicken thighs in a ziplock bag, pour the teriyaki marinade over the chicken. Seal the bag and make sure the chicken is well coated. Marinate for at least 30 minutes.
- Heat a skillet over medium heat. Remove chicken from the marinade, reserving the marinade, and cook the chicken thighs for about 6-7 minutes on each side, or until cooked through and golden brown on the outside.
- Pour the reserved marinade into the skillet and simmer until it reduces to a thick glossy sauce.
- Slice the chicken and serve it on top of cooked white rice. Drizzle the reduced teriyaki sauce over the chicken and garnish with chopped spring onions. Serve hot.
